ECOWAS COMMISSION PRESIDENT LAUNCHES STAFF TRANSPORTATION INITIATIVE TO IMPROVE STAFF WELFARE AND PRODUCTIVITY

The President of the ECOWAS Commission, H.E. General Birame Diop, officially launched a dedicated staff transportation initiative aimed at improving employee welfare, facilitating daily commuting and enhancing institutional productivity. The programme, launched in the presence of the Vice-President of the ECOWAS Commission, H.E. Anthony Oluwatosin Ogunjimi, begins operations with an initial fleet comprising one 25-seat staff bus and two 18-seat buses, providing structured transportation between designated pick-up points and the ECOWAS Commission Headquarters in Abuja.

The initiative reflects the Commission leadership’s commitment to translating staff concerns into practical and measurable solutions that improve both working conditions and organizational effectiveness.

Speaking during the launch, President Diop underscored that responsive leadership requires listening to staff needs and delivering tangible results. He noted that the transportation scheme is designed to ease the financial and logistical burden of daily commuting, strengthen punctuality, improve safety and contribute to greater efficiency across the institution. Calling on beneficiaries to make responsible use of the service and adhere to established schedules and routes, he reaffirmed the Commission’s commitment to progressively expanding the programme to reach more staff members in the future.
